Roshni Nadar Malhotra: From Heir to India’s Third-Richest Individual

Born in 1982 in New Delhi, Roshni Nadar Malhotra is the only child of Shiv and Kiran Nadar. She pursued her early education at Vasant Valley School and later earned a degree in Communications from Northwestern University, followed by an MBA from the Kellogg School of Management. Before joining HCL, Roshni gained experience as a news producer with Sky News UK and CNN America.
In 2009, she joined HCL Corporation, and within a year, she was appointed as the executive director and CEO. Her leadership was further solidified when she became the chairperson of HCL Technologies, making her the first woman to lead a listed IT company in India.
Philanthropy and Environmental Advocacy
Beyond her corporate responsibilities, Roshni is deeply committed to philanthropy and environmental conservation. She serves as a trustee of the Shiv Nadar Foundation, which focuses on education and societal transformation. Under her guidance, initiatives like VidyaGyan were established to nurture leadership among underprivileged students.
In 2018, she founded The Habitats Trust, aiming to protect India’s natural habitats and indigenous species, reflecting her dedication to sustainable ecosystems.
Global Influence and Recognition
Roshni’s influence extends globally through her roles on various prestigious boards. She is a member of the Dean’s Advisory Council at the MIT School of Engineering and serves on the Executive Board for Asia at the Kellogg School of Management. Additionally, she is a board member of the US-India Strategic Partnership Forum (USISPF) and serves on the global board of directors of The Nature Conservancy (TNC).
Her contributions have been recognized internationally, and she was ranked 55th on Forbes’ World’s 100 Most Powerful Women list in 2023.
Personal Life
In her personal life, Roshni is married to Shikhar Malhotra, the vice chairman of HCL Healthcare. The couple has two sons. Despite her elevated status in the business world, Roshni maintains a low public profile, focusing on her work and philanthropic endeavors.
